Episode 3317: Darrow Kirkpatrick explores the two dominant schools of retirement income planning: probability-based strategies, which rely on investment growth and withdrawal methods, and safety-first approaches, which prioritize guaranteed income through annuities or bonds. He highlights the strengths and pitfalls of each, noting that the most practical solution for many retirees is often a thoughtful combination of both philosophies. Read along with the original article(s) here: https://www.caniretireyet.com/are-you-feeling-lucky-the-two-schools-of-retirement-income/ Quotes to ponder: "In the safety-first philosophy, you, or a financial planner, match guaranteed income to essential expenses." "A failure probability in the neighborhood of 10% is often considered acceptable. That’s one chance in ten." "Failure is defined as running out of money before running out of life." Episode 3316: Joel shares the real challenges of managing rental properties far from home, from unexpected repair costs and multiple state tax filings to navigating local laws and building trust with teams you’ve never met in person. With practical strategies and personal lessons learned, he shows how to handle these obstacles while reminding us why real estate can still be worth the effort. Episode 3315: Sam Dogen explores the psychology behind overspending and how to recognize the emotional triggers that lead to impulse purchases. By shifting focus toward long-term satisfaction, building awareness, and setting up practical guardrails, he shows how to resist the urge to splurge and create a healthier relationship with money. Episode 3313: Jen Hayes challenges the common belief that student loans are “good debt,” showing how high interest, limited return on investment, and the inability to discharge loans in bankruptcy can create a lifelong financial burden. She urges students to consider alternatives, such as working and saving before pursuing a degree, and to be strategic about choosing affordable education paths with practical majors. Read along with the original article(s) here: https://www.jenhayes.me/student-loans-bad-debt/ Quotes to ponder: "Interest on student loans compounds, this means that the interest itself collects interest." "Student loan debt, unlike most other forms of debt, cannot be eliminated during bankruptcy." "Whatever you decide to do, don’t believe the lie that student loans are 'good' debt."
